The CVE-2002-0641 issue affects Microsoft SQL Server 2000 and MSDE 2000, where a buffer overflow in the BULK INSERT procedure can be triggered by a file name that is too long. Exploitation requires Bulk Admin or Administrator privileges and can allow execution of arbitrary code with system/high p...
CVE-2002-0624
CVE-2002-0624 describes a buffer overflow in the pwdencrypt() password-encryption function in Microsoft SQL Server 2000 (including MSDE 2000) that can all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code with the SQL Server service account when authenticating via SQL Server Authentication. Microsoft SQL Server 2000 pwdencrypt() buffer overflow
Microsoft SQL Server 2000 up to SP2 suffers from buffer/heap overflow in built-in hashing function pwdencrypt. Sample code shown below crashes SQL Server service and may lead to arbitrary code execution: SELECT pwdencryptREPLICATE'A',353 On some systems it may require lager amount of characters t...
